Understanding the Landscape: Free vs. Paid Options
Before we jump into the free stuff, let's briefly look at the bigger picture. There are generally two main ways to watch Fox: paid and free. The paid options, like cable, satellite, and subscription streaming services, usually offer the most reliable and convenient access to Fox, along with a ton of other channels and on-demand content. However, these come with monthly fees, which can quickly add up. Cable and satellite, in particular, often require long-term contracts and can be quite expensive. Subscription streaming services like Hulu + Live TV, YouTube TV, and Sling TV also carry Fox, but they also have a monthly cost. These services give you live access to Fox, plus a library of on-demand shows and movies. They are generally more affordable than cable, but still involve a recurring payment.
Then there are the free options, which is what we're really after here. These typically involve streaming through over-the-air (OTA) antennas or using free streaming platforms. The upside? No monthly fees! The downside? You might have to deal with ads, limited content availability, and sometimes, a less-than-perfect viewing experience. Over-the-Air (OTA) Antennas: The Classic Free Route
Alright, let's start with the OG of free TV: the over-the-air (OTA) antenna. This is a classic method that's been around for ages, and it still works like a charm. An OTA antenna pulls in signals broadcast by local TV stations, including Fox, directly from the airwaves. This means you don't need an internet connection or a cable subscription. The only cost is the antenna itself, which is a one-time purchase. Depending on your location and the type of antenna you choose, you can get a surprising number of channels, often including all the major networks like Fox, ABC, NBC, and CBS, plus a bunch of local stations. This is a solid solution if you're looking for how to watch Fox TV for free.
Setting up an OTA antenna is pretty straightforward. First, you'll need to buy an antenna. There are two main types: indoor and outdoor. Indoor antennas are easy to set up and great for apartments or areas with strong signal strengths. Outdoor antennas are more powerful and better for areas with weaker signals or lots of obstructions. Next, you need to find the optimal location for your antenna. The higher up, the better, as it can clear obstructions. You can use websites like AntennaWeb or TVFool to check the signal strength in your area and find the best direction to point your antenna. Finally, connect the antenna to your TV. Most modern TVs have a built-in digital tuner, so you can simply plug the antenna's cable into the antenna input on your TV. Then, go to your TV's settings and scan for channels. Your TV will scan the airwaves and find all the available channels in your area. You're all set! It's important to remember that the quality of your OTA reception can vary depending on your location, the weather, and any obstructions in the area, such as buildings or trees. Free Streaming Platforms: The Modern Way to Watch Fox
Okay, let's talk about the modern way to watch Fox TV for free: free streaming platforms. These platforms offer a variety of content, including live TV, on-demand shows, and movies, all without a subscription fee. However, they usually come with ads, which is how they make money. While the content may not be as extensive as the paid streaming services, there are some legitimate options available for streaming Fox content.
Tubi
Tubi is a popular free streaming service with a vast library of movies and TV shows. While it doesn't offer live Fox TV, it does have a selection of Fox shows on-demand. This means you can catch up on past episodes of your favorite shows. The content selection is always changing, so it's a good idea to check regularly to see what's available. The ads can be a bit annoying, but hey, it's free! For many viewers, this is the easiest way to watch Fox TV for free.
The Roku Channel
The Roku Channel is another great option for free streaming. Like Tubi, it offers a mix of movies and TV shows, with a growing number of on-demand Fox shows available. If you have a Roku device or a smart TV with the Roku operating system, you can easily access The Roku Channel. Even if you don't have a Roku device, you can often access The Roku Channel through its website or app on other devices.
Other Free Streaming Services
Keep an eye out for other free streaming services that may carry Fox content, like Pluto TV and Xumo. These platforms are constantly updating their libraries, so it's worth checking them out to see what shows are available. The selection varies, so it's wise to explore what they offer.
